Maximum clocking frequency of MPMC

Hi All,

 

I am implementing an MPMC controller on a spartan 6 FPGA. What is the maximum clocking frequency which the MPMC can support as I couldn't find any documentation.

Re: Maximum clocking frequency of MPMC

The maximum frequency depends on the type of exernal memory you use, and possibly

also on the speed grade of your FPGA.  There is more information in the MIG user's guide.

MIG is the underlying memory interface used by the MPMC.
